|
Share capital, Convertible Note Agreement (Details)
SFr in Thousands, $ in Millions
|12 Months Ended
|
Dec. 31, 2021
CHF (SFr)
Agreement
shares
|
Dec. 31, 2021
USD ($)
shares
|
Dec. 31, 2020
CHF (SFr)
|
Dec. 31, 2019
CHF (SFr)
|
Dec. 31, 2021
USD ($)
Agreement
|Convertible Note Agreement [Abstract]
|Net proceeds | SFr
|SFr 23,463
|SFr 0
|SFr 50,278
|Convertible Note Agreement [Member]
|Convertible Note Agreement [Abstract]
|Number of separate convertible note agreements | Agreement
|2
|2
|Aggregate principal amount
|SFr 11,700
|$ 12.5
|Net proceeds
|SFr 23,500
|$ 25.0
|Number of shares in conversion of debt (in shares)
|3,026,634
|3,026,634
|Convertible Note Agreement [Member] | Athos Service GmbH [Member]
|Convertible Note Agreement [Abstract]
|Number of shares in conversion of debt (in shares)
|1,513,317
|1,513,317
|Convertible Note Agreement [Member] | First Capital Partner GmbH [Member]
|Convertible Note Agreement [Abstract]
|Number of shares in conversion of debt (in shares)
|1,513,317
|1,513,317
|X
- Definition
+ References
The carrying amount of debt identified as being convertible into another form of financial instrument.
+ Details
No definition available.
|X
- References
+ Details
No definition available.
|X
- Definition
+ References
The increase in the number of ordinary shares issued under a convertible debt arrangement upon conversion of the debt.
+ Details
No definition available.
|X
- Definition
+ References
The number of convertible notes with Affiris affiliated entities.
+ Details
No definition available.
|X
- Definition
+ References
The cash inflow from the issuing of convertible debt.
+ Details
No definition available.
|X
- Details
|X
- Details
|X
- Details